03-31-2018, 10:45 PMMaybe a small question, but a useful one :)
I've worn out my first pinlock in that there's no seal anymore. It seems like it fits poorly and barely has any tension on it.
Before I buy a new one, I want to ask how they usually wear out.
How long should a pinlock layer last?
Does it usually change shape and lose fit?

If the pinlock visor fits well on the normal visor the only wear out are cracks vor scratches in the layers. But it depends very mich how well it fit. I had good and poor experienes. And the poor once habe been on real expensive helmet ....

I have had the same pinlock visor in my helmet for 2 years with no sign of deterioration, discoloring or cracking. I love it and would never go back to anything else. My next helmet will most definitely have a pinlock visor.
